AN ACT to amend the judiciary law, in relation to waiving the biennial
attorney registration fee for New York attorneys who meet the federal
public service loan forgiveness program employment qualifications
TH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M-
B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S:
Section 1. Subdivision 4 of section 468-a of the judiciary law, as
amended by section 9 of part K of chapter 56 of the laws of 2010, is
amended to read as follows:
4. The biennial registration fee shall be three hundred seventy-five
dollars, sixty dollars of which shall be allocated to and be deposited
in a fund established pursuant to the provisions of section ninety-sev-
en-t of the state finance law, fifty dollars of which shall be allocated
to and shall be deposited in a fund established pursuant to the
provisions of section ninety-eight-b of the state finance law, twenty-
five dollars of which shall be allocated to be deposited in a fund
established pursuant to the provisions of section ninety-eight-c of the
state finance law, and the remainder of which shall be deposited in the
attorney licensing fund. Such fee shall be required of every attorney
who is admitted and licensed to practice law in this state, whether or
not the attorney is engaged in the practice of law in this state or
elsewhere, except attorneys who certify to the chief administrator of
the courts that they have EITHER retired from the practice of law OR MET
THE EMPLOYMENT REQUIREMENTS FOR PARTICIPATION OF THE FEDERAL PUBLIC
SERVICE LOAN FORGIVENESS PROGRAM AS SET OUT IN 34 CFR 685.219.
§ 2. This act shall take effect on the ninetieth day after it shall
have become a law; provided, however that effective immediately, the
addition, amendment and/or repeal of any rules or regulations necessary
for the implementation of the foregoing provisions of this act on its
effective date are authorized and directed to be made and completed on
or before such effective date.
